In the ever-evolving world of technology, understanding how networks perform under different conditions is crucial. The Postgraduate Certificate in Network Simulation and Performance Evaluation is designed to equip professionals with the knowledge and skills to analyze, simulate, and optimize network performance. This program is not just about understanding the theory; it’s about applying that knowledge in real-world scenarios to solve complex problems.
Essential Skills for Network Simulation and Performance Evaluation
The first step in mastering network simulation and performance evaluation is to develop a strong foundation of essential skills. Here are some key areas to focus on:
1. Programming and Scripting: Proficiency in programming languages like Python, Java, or C++ is vital. These languages not only help in writing simulation models but also in analyzing large datasets. Learning how to script can automate repetitive tasks and speed up the simulation process.
2. Mathematical and Statistical Knowledge: Understanding statistical methods and mathematical models is crucial. This includes probability theory, queueing theory, and optimization techniques. These skills help in modeling network behavior and predicting performance under various conditions.
3. Networking Basics: A solid understanding of network protocols, topologies, and services is necessary. This includes TCP/IP, OSI model, and common network issues like congestion and packet loss. Knowing these basics ensures that simulations are realistic and relevant.
4. Simulation Tools and Software: Familiarity with simulation software like NS2, OMNeT++, or GNS3 is important. These tools allow you to model and simulate network scenarios in a controlled environment, which is essential for testing new ideas and optimizing network performance.
Best Practices for Network Simulation and Performance Evaluation
Once you have the essential skills, applying best practices can significantly enhance your ability to simulate and evaluate network performance effectively. Here are some best practices to consider:
1. Define Clear Objectives: Before starting any simulation, define what you want to achieve. Whether it’s improving network efficiency, reducing latency, or enhancing security, having clear objectives ensures that the simulation is targeted and useful.
2. Use Realistic Data: Simulations that use realistic data are more accurate and useful. This includes considering real-world network traffic patterns, user behavior, and hardware limitations. Realistic data helps in identifying real-world issues and validating the simulation results.
3. Validate and Verify: Validation involves checking that the simulation accurately models the real-world scenario, while verification ensures that the simulation itself is correct. Regularly validating and verifying simulations can help in refining the model and improving its accuracy.
4. Iterative Process: Simulations are often iterative. Initial models may not perfectly capture all aspects of the network. It’s important to continually refine the model based on feedback and new data. This iterative process ensures that the simulation accurately reflects real-world conditions.
Career Opportunities in Network Simulation and Performance Evaluation
The skills and knowledge gained from the Postgraduate Certificate in Network Simulation and Performance Evaluation open up a wide range of career opportunities in the tech industry. Here are some potential career paths:
1. Network Engineer: Network engineers use simulation to design and optimize network infrastructure. They are responsible for ensuring that networks perform efficiently and reliably.
2. Performance Analyst: Performance analysts use simulation to identify bottlenecks and improve network performance. They work closely with network engineers to implement changes and monitor the impact on network performance.
3. Research and Development: Many companies and academic institutions are always looking for professionals to work on cutting-edge research projects related to network simulation and performance evaluation. This can include developing new simulation tools or exploring innovative network architectures.
4. Consultant: Network simulation and performance evaluation skills are in high demand among consulting firms. These firms often work with clients to assess and improve network performance, which can involve simulations and other analytical techniques.
Conclusion
The Postgraduate Certificate in Network Simulation and Performance Evaluation is a valuable asset in today’s tech-driven world. By developing essential skills